Citi Trends robbed at gunpoint

Published 9:58 pm Tuesday, December 18, 2018

AHOSKIE – Citi Trends, located in Newmarket Shopping Center, was robbed at gunpoint tonight (Tuesday).

Ahoskie Police Chief Troy Fitzhugh told the R-C News-Herald that two male suspects are involved in the heist.

He said the duo – each wearing dark clothing with their faces covered – entered the store at 8 p.m. Both suspects, he said, brandished a firearm.

“They took an undisclosed amount of money from the cash register and fled,” Fitzhugh stated.

He added there were customers in the store at the time of the robbery. There are no reported injuries.

Fitzhugh said it is believed the suspects left the scene in a vehicle.

“If anyone was in that area, in the vicinity of the shopping center or along Memorial Drive or Jersey Street, at that time and witnessed a vehicle traveling at a high rate of speed, we would like to hear from you,” Fitzhugh said.

APD Detective Justin Farmer is investigating the armed robbery.

Those with information are encouraged to immediately contact the Hertford County E-911 Communications Center at 252-358-0232.
